A Little Cabin in the Woods was painted by Artist Jennifer Lake. The Cabin is snuggled in the woods under a majestic mountain. The fall season has arrived and a fire is in the fireplace, a pumpkin sits on the porch and wood is chopped for winter. Squirrels are seen gathering pine cones for their stash for winter. The fall ferns and lupines are slowly fading. Hawks spy the activity high in the pine trees...and watch for the arrival of winter.
A delightful piece for anyone that loves the great outdoors and detail.

International artist Jennifer Lake is an amazingly versatile artist. Best known for her detailed folk art paintings, her work is cherished by collectors internationally and in the United States, Canada and Japan. Many of her print series have completely sold out. There are over 800 paintings in the collection and more than two million prints have been sold, making her one of the most collected artist in the Northwest. Her work has been featured in numerous newspaper articles, magazines and television programs here and abroad; the most exciting of which was her tours in Japan and Canada.
